The oscars start time 2025 was officially set for 7:00 p.m. ET / 4:00 p.m. PT on Sunday, March 2, 2025.
If you were expecting that old-school 8:00 p.m. kickoff, you basically missed the first third of the show. The Academy shifted things earlier to help the East Coast actually stay awake for Best Picture, and frankly, to give ABC a better lead-in for the late-night news.

What time did the red carpet actually begin?
If you live for the fashion, the "official" pre-show started at 6:30 p.m. ET / 3:30 p.m. PT.
However, if you’re a real red carpet nerd, the E! network and various livestreams usually start circling the Dolby Theatre as early as 4:00 p.m. ET. For the 2025 show, Julianne Hough and Jesse Palmer handled the official ABC duties. Where Everyone Watched (and Where They Re-Watch Now)
ABC is still the king of the Oscars, but 2025 was a bit of a milestone. For the first time, Hulu streamed the ceremony live for its subscribers.
It wasn't perfectly smooth, though.
Some users complained on social media that the Hulu feed cut off right before the final awards. Disney ended up apologizing for the technical glitch. If you missed it or your stream died, you can still find the full replay on Hulu or ABC.com. Just keep in mind that these rights are tricky; usually, the full broadcast is only available for a few weeks after the air date before it gets chopped up into individual clips on YouTube.
International viewers had it rougher
While Americans were eating dinner, fans in the UK were brewing coffee for a 12:00 a.m. GMT start. In Australia, it was Monday morning, March 3rd. The show was broadcast in over 200 territories, including:
- Australia: Seven Network / 7Plus
- UK: ITV / ITVX
- Canada: CTV
What actually happened during that 2025 broadcast?
The show ran for about 3 hours and 50 minutes. That’s long, but for an Oscars telecast, it’s actually somewhat efficient.
Anora was the big winner of the night, taking home five awards including Best Picture. Sean Baker made history with that win, proving that indie film still has a massive pulse in Hollywood. Adrien Brody grabbed Best Actor for The Brutalist, while Mikey Madison took home Best Actress for Anora.
